Educational Marketing Strategies
As the demand for education continues to increase, the need to effectively market educational services is becoming an ever-more important part of success. this article will provide an outline of 3 major steps on educational marketing strategies that can be used to help successfully promote educational services

3 major steps for effective educational marketing
• Leveraging existing contacts
• Developing a strong online presence
• Utilizing social media to reach potential students.
Each topic will be explored in detail to provide a comprehensive overview of how to effectively market educational services.
1. Leveraging existing contacts
Using existing contacts, educational institutions can tap into relationships that have already been established and take advantage of these relationships to maximize their marketing efforts.
So, how can a school leverage existing contacts to create effective educational marketing?
• First and foremost, schools should make sure that they are creating content that is relevant to their current contacts. This will help to ensure that their content is seen by their contacts and will help to create a better connection with them. Additionally, schools should make sure that they are engaging with their contacts on a regular basis. This could include responding to posts or questions, engaging in conversations, and sharing content.
• Another way to leverage existing contacts is to host events. Hosting events can help to create a sense of community and bring people into the school. This is especially important for schools that may have limited reach through traditional marketing methods. Hosting events can also offer an opportunity for schools to network with existing contacts, as well as build relationships with potential students.
2. Developing a strong online presence
Developing a strong online presence is essential for effective educational marketing. In today’s digital world, having an online presence is key to reaching potential students, engaging current students, and staying competitive in the educational market.
To develop a strong online presence, it’s important to have a comprehensive digital strategy. This strategy should include a website, social media, content marketing, and email campaigns.
• Your website should be the cornerstone of your online presence. It should be easy to navigate, visually appealing, and contain relevant, up-to-date information about your institution. Additionally, your website should have an SEO strategy in place to ensure that it’s visible in search engine results.
• Social media is a great way to engage with potential and current students. It’s important to have a presence on the major social media platforms, such as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and YouTube. Posting relevant content and responding to messages quickly will help to foster relationships with your audience.
• email campaigns are a great way to stay in touch with potential and current students. Create an email list and send out newsletters and other content that is relevant to your audience.
3. Utilizing social media to reach potential students
Social media has become an increasingly popular tool for educational marketing, allowing institutions to reach a larger audience and create a stronger connection with their target demographic. Utilizing social media to reach potential students is a powerful tool for effective educational marketing.
• By creating engaging content that resonates with potential students, institutions can effectively reach out to their target audience and build relationships with them. Additionally, social media can be used to share valuable information with potential students, such as upcoming events, scholarship opportunities, and other important information through which institutions can create a positive impression and increase their visibility.
• social media can also be used to increase enrollment by creating an effective lead generation system. By creating content that encourages potential students to take action, such as signing up for a newsletter or attending an event, institutions can increase their enrollment numbers. Additionally, institutions can use social media to collect valuable data about potential students, such as their interests and preferences, which can be used to tailor future marketing efforts.
